OKR Framework: Objectives and Key Results

Complete guide to implementing OKRs for goal setting and alignment

Complete guide to implementing Objectives and Key Results (OKRs) for exponential growth. OKRs consist of qualitative, inspirational objectives paired with 3-5 quantitative key results. The framework bridges strategy and execution through clear alignment, regular check-ins, and adaptive goal-setting. Best practices include setting 3-5 objectives per cycle, using different metric types (input, output, outcome), and supporting with Conversations, Feedback, and Recognition (CFRs). Proven methodology used by Intel, Google, and many successful organizations.
